After a breather issue last time, we get a new storyline involving the Academy students, and it's great to see that they actually DO seem to have matured a little bit. And it's a doozy. While Pym and Quicksilver are handling a situation in Italy, it comes down to Tigra and the students to handle a break-in by Electro at a tech lab. Of course, as you can probably tell by the cover, Electro's not alone, nor is he the mastermind of this one. This issue is VERY action heavy, I guess to make up for the pretty light fare last month, and it delivers on what the cover promises. This is a battle, flat out, and it's a very entertaining one. The Sinister Six make great villains to counter the Academy students. And of course, the effect the battle has on the kids, and on Pym himself, is not left on the cutting room floor. This is one of the few times I've seen the consequences and collateral damage of a superhero fight directly addressed, and it's heartbreaking how it affects Pym.
